Cópia Segura no Linux

LinuxBeginner
Pratique Agora

Introdução

Numa era há muito esquecida, aninhada nas profundezas da antiga selva amazônica, encontra-se uma cachoeira mística guardada por uma entidade ancestral conhecida como o Guardião da Cascata. Rumores dizem que esta cachoeira etérea contém os segredos para compreender a linguagem ancestral da Cópia Segura (Secure Copying), conhecida pelos sábios como SCP. Como um criptógrafo aspirante, sua missão é aprender os ritos sagrados do SCP para transportar com segurança dados preciosos através do terreno traiçoeiro de computadores em rede, garantindo que seu tesouro permaneça intocado pelas entidades maléficas que espreitam no reino sombrio digital.

O Guardião da Cascata, um espírito ligado ao dever, irá guiá-lo pelos caminhos ocultos e transmitir o conhecimento necessário para dominar a arte da transmissão segura de arquivos. Seu objetivo é transferir com sucesso uma série de textos arcanos de um templo remoto para outro, utilizando os poderosos comandos do SCP sem alertar as forças sombrias que observam cobiçosamente das trevas.

Este laboratório desafiará suas habilidades, aprimorará suas habilidades na linha de comando e, finalmente, concederá a você a dádiva da proficiência em Linux Secure Copying. Prepare-se para uma aventura de mística criptográfica e domínio de comandos de terminal.

Estabelecendo uma Conexão

Nesta etapa, você estabelecerá uma conexão segura entre sua câmara local e o servidor do templo distante usando o protocolo SCP. Para iniciar os ritos de iniciação, você deve criar um arquivo de texto sagrado que contenha as antigas invocações e transferi-lo com segurança para o altar localizado na câmara oculta do templo.

Primeiro, crie o arquivo de texto sagrado:

echo "Ancient wisdom of the Guardian." > ~/project/sacred-text.txt

Em seguida, transfira o texto sagrado para o servidor do templo distante:

scp ~/project/sacred-text.txt username@remotehost:/path/to/remote/directory

Por favor, substitua username pelo seu nome de usuário real e remotehost pelo nome de host ou endereço IP real do servidor remoto. O /path/to/remote/directory deve ser substituído pelo caminho real para o diretório onde você deseja que o arquivo resida no servidor remoto.

Você deve ver uma saída semelhante a:

sacred-text.txt                                  100%   29    0.3KB/s   00:00

Recuperando os Pergaminhos Codificados

Com o texto sagrado colocado no altar, é hora de recuperar os Pergaminhos Codificados da câmara do templo. Nesta etapa, você usará SCP para copiar com segurança o diretório dos pergaminhos do servidor remoto para sua câmara local para decifração.

Veja como realizar a recuperação sagrada:

scp -r username@remotehost:/path/to/remote/scrolls-directory ~/project/local-scrolls

Substitua username, remotehost e /path/to/remote/scrolls-directory pelo usuário, host e caminho do diretório apropriados que você está acessando.

Após a execução bem-sucedida, você deverá ver uma série de saídas indicando o progresso de cada pergaminho sendo copiado, semelhante a isto:

scroll1.txt                                  100%  104    1.0KB/s   00:01
scroll2.txt                                  100%  256    2.6KB/s   00:01

Resumo

Neste laboratório, aventuramo-nos pelos mistérios do protocolo SCP em um cenário inspirado na antiga selva amazônica. Você aprendeu a estabelecer conexões seguras e transferir arquivos de um local para outro, uma habilidade crucial no reino do Linux. Abraçando a narrativa de um espírito guardião, infundimos um senso de aventura em um processo tipicamente técnico, tornando sua experiência de aprendizado informativa e cativante.